A guide to the fundamental chemistry and recent advances of battery
materials In one comprehensive volume, Inorganic Battery Materials
explores the basic chemistry principles, recent advances, and the
challenges and opportunities of the current and emerging
technologies of battery materials. With contributions from an
international panel of experts, this authoritative resource
contains information on the fundamental features of battery
materials, discussions on material synthesis, structural
characterizations and electrochemical reactions. The book explores
a wide range of topics including the state-of-the-art lithium ion
battery chemistry to more energy-aggressive chemistries involving
lithium metal. The authors also include a review of sulfur and
oxygen, aqueous battery chemistry, redox flow battery chemistry,
solid state battery chemistry and environmentally beneficial carbon
dioxide battery chemistry. In the context of renewable energy
utilization and transportation electrification, battery
technologies have been under more extensive and intensive
development than ever. This important book: Provides an
understanding of the chemistry of a battery technology Explores
battery technology's potential as well as the obstacles that hamper
the potential from being realized Highlights new applications and
points out the potential growth areas that can serve as
inspirations for future research Includes an understanding of the
chemistry of battery materials and how they store and convert
energy Written for students and academics in the fields of energy
materials, electrochemistry, solid state chemistry, inorganic
materials chemistry and materials science, Inorganic Battery
Materials focuses on the inorganic chemistry of battery materials
associated with both current and future battery technologies to
provide a unique reference in the field. About EIBC Books The
Encyclopedia of Inorganic and Bioinorganic Chemistry (EIBC) was
created as an online reference in 2012 by merging the Encyclopedia
of Inorganic Chemistry and the Handbook of Metalloproteins. The
resulting combination proves to be the defining reference work in
the field of inorganic and bioinorganic chemistry, and a lot of
chemistry libraries around the world have access to the online
version. Many readers, however, prefer to have more concise
thematic volumes in print, targeted to their specific area of
interest. This feedback from EIBC readers has encouraged the
Editors to plan a series of EIBC Books [formerly called EIC Books],
focusing on topics of current interest. EIBC Books will appear on a
regular basis, will be edited by the EIBC Editors and specialist
Guest Editors, and will feature articles from leading scholars in
their fields. EIBC Books aim to provide both the starting research
student and the confirmed research worker with a critical
distillation of the leading concepts in inorganic and bioinorganic
chemistry, and provide a structured entry into the fields covered.
